Description

The Atmosphere Cluster (AC) under the Division of Atmospheric and Geospace Sciences supports fundamental research on atmospheric processes, covering chemical, physical, and dynamic aspects that affect clouds, climate, weather, and the water cycle. This includes studies on atmospheric gases, climate dynamics, paleoclimate, atmospheric motions, and meteorology using modeling, experiments, and observations.
